
Anyma Releases Rap-Infused ‘Work’ Alongside Yeat
Anyma joins forces with iconic rapper, Yeat to release their new single ‘Work‘. The two debuted ‘Work’ for the first time during a live performance at The Sphere in Las Vegas in front of thousands of fans building massive hype up until today. This performance marked the first time a rapper has performed at this iconic venue. ‘Work’
Anyma’s ‘Work’ starts with a classic Anyma electro synth that is quickly emphasized with a heavy drum groove, bass synth, and Yeat’s powerful low vocals. Altogether, these elements build up to a drop that consists of a bass-heavy rhythm and “work” chorus. The vocals in this drop radiate space with beautifully constructed reverb and mixing techniques. After, a spacious breakdown fills the track and gives listeners an easy pallet cleanser before the last drop. In the end, the final drop carries similar energy to the first and adds a melodic and arpeggiated synth.
Anyma’s New Album “The End of Genesys“
In the wake of Anyma’s 12-date residency at The Sphere, the first electronic residency at the venue, he is releasing single after single leading up to his new album, “The End of Genesys.” This new discography features collaborations with artists such as Grimes, FKA Twigs, 070 Shake, Luke Steele of Empire of the Sun, and more. Already, ‘Angel In The Dark,’ ‘Hypnotized‘ with Ellie Goulding, ‘Voices In My Head‘ with Argy and Son of Son, and ‘Neverland‘ with Baset are out and ready for your ears. Collectively, this whole album will be released on May 23rd, 2025.
Official Visualiser Music Video
The amount of work Anyma puts into each release is not limited to his musical production. Each track usually receives a visual identity as well for his notable live performances. For Example, ‘Welcome To The Opera‘ by Anyma and Grimes has a special visual where Anyma’s Cyborg takes on the identity of Grimes who is trying to get out of the glass box it seems to be trapped in. Now, ‘Work’ has its own visual sensation as well and is already on YouTube. The single scene video radiates the darker energy the new Anyma single brings to his tracklist. The camera circles rapper Yeat and Anyma back to back with intriguing movements and facial expressions. Also, ‘Yeat’ adds an exceptional twist by wearing a dune-like regulator.
